What a night it’s been for the all those who attended the 82nd Annual Academy Awards but more importantly, what a night for Goddiva’s Design Team!!

The Goddiva Design Team watched the 82nd Annual Academy Awards on Sunday 7th March and chose Carey Mulligan’s Prada Dress to recreate and have ready to present to GMTV and it’s viewers by 9:20 on Monday morning (8th March)!!
The Girls watching the Oscars to select a dress to recreate
With great organisational and design skills, lots of excitement and a dash of adrenaline, the Goddiva Design Team worked throughout the early hours of Monday morning to recreate this beautiful dress with the GMTV crew behind them every step of the way.
